'This page is devoted to collecting resources for understanding community in the broadest sense. It will include the study of traditional "community development" of physical community assets as well as the human assets that make a community valuable socially, politically, and economically. It will also offer study options that relate to empowering communities through community self-awareness, individual participation, and leadership.'
